Installing home windows may look simple—pop one out, slide another in, and voila! —but it’s realistically a complex process that requires more effort than swapping out a picture frame. DIY window installations can compromise performance, longevity, and quality. So, before you grab a hammer or hire a handy neighbor, consider the pros and cons of different installation options.

The Risks of DIY Window Installation

DIY projects can be fun because they give you a sense of accomplishment. But when it comes to windows, doing it yourself can lead to significant consequences, like leaky seals, improper alignments, and voided warranties.

Common Problems with Improperly Installed Windows

  • Water damage. Poor sealing allows water to seep in, compromising the integrity of your windows with potential mold and decay.
  • Increased energy costs. When window installation is misaligned, it can cause gaps that compromise interior temperature control. This means your HVAC system is working overtime.
  • Fogged windows. The double-pane glass shouldn’t fog. If you see fogginess, the seal has failed, and the window needs to be re-aligned.

Handyman vs. Expert Services: What’s the Difference?

So, your neighborhood handyman swears he can do windows. However, just because someone can wield a hammer doesn’t mean they’re equipped to handle complex window installation. Handymen may be less expensive, but many lack the specialized skills to install home windows. In contrast, expert window installers have specialized training, often coming with warranties and an understanding of local building codes and the best practices in the industry.

The Benefits of Hiring a Professional Installer

  • Fitted with precision. Professionals ensure windows are perfectly installed—no gaps or misalignment.
  • Guaranteed workmanship. Professionals offer warranties, standing behind the quality of their work to give you peace of mind.
  • Boosted energy efficiency. Proper window installation adds insulation, maximizing energy efficiency and lowering utility costs.

Finding a Qualified Window Installer

Not all window installers are created equal. Do your homework to find the right pro for the job. Check for certifications to ensure window installation companies are certified by organizations like the American Window and Door Institute. Ask about warranties to cover installation work, not just the windows. Finally, read reviews. Do your research.
